Post by robster » Thu Jul 15, 2010 7:25 pm

Hi

I have also bought this mod and prety damn good it is too. However I have a slight problem. Everything seems to work fine except I get the following text in the order ocnfirmation emails:

Notice: Undefined index: aoption in /home/robsnow/public_html/opencart/catalog/view/theme/default/template/mail/order_confirm.tpl on line 72Warning: Invalid argument supplied for foreach() in /home/robsnow/public_html/opencart/catalog/view/theme/default/template/mail/order_confirm.tpl on line 72 Notice: Undefined index: txtoption in /home/robsnow/public_html/opencart/catalog/view/theme/default/template/mail/order_confirm.tpl on line 76Warning: Invalid argument supplied for foreach() in /home/robsnow/public_html/opencart/catalog/view/theme/default/template/mail/order_confirm.tpl on line 76

Errr - is this chinese? Seriously if anybody can assist in helping resolve this matter then I would be very grateful.

Post by readyman » Fri Jul 16, 2010 8:38 am

Please, please, seriously contact me direct especially if you bought it from me... I have already updated the zip files with this problem.
All you need to do is remove the extra $aoptions & $txtoptions variables and just keep the normal $options ones. But if you don't know PHP, I am always ready to help.
